## Firm Overview

Youngers Law, PA is a New Mexico plaintiff-side litigation firm representing individuals and families who have been harmed by negligence, misconduct, or intentional acts. The firm handles personal injury, wrongful death, civil rights, sexual abuse, employment, and related civil matters, and represents clients throughout the state of New Mexico.

The firm is owned by trial attorney Joleen K. Youngers, who has approximately three decades of experience litigating on behalf of injured people, survivors of wrongful death, and victims of civil rights violations and workplace misconduct. Attorney Victor Reyes practices with the firm in personal injury and civil rights matters.

Youngers Law operates from offices in Santa Fe and Las Cruces and represents clients across New Mexico, including Albuquerque, Española, Los Alamos, Gallup, and Angel Fire. The firm emphasizes individualized client attention and courtroom advocacy, and offers free consultations for personal injury, medical malpractice, sexual abuse, and certain other claims.

## Attorneys

### Joleen K. Youngers – Owner and Trial Attorney

Joleen K. Youngers is a trial attorney and the owner of Youngers Law, PA. Her practice focuses on wrongful death, personal injury, civil rights, sexual abuse, discrimination, sexual harassment, and whistleblower cases. In addition to her litigation practice, she serves as a personal representative in wrongful death claims and as a guardian ad litem for children and incapacitated persons in personal injury and civil rights litigation. She has approximately three decades of litigation experience.

Ms. Youngers frequently teaches trial advocacy and Continuing Legal Education courses. She instructs in National Institute of Trial Advocacy (NITA) trial practice and deposition skills programs across the United States and internationally, and has served as an adjunct professor at the University of New Mexico School of Law, coaching and lecturing on trial skills and co-teaching Evidence and Trial Practice. She serves on the board of the New Mexico Trial Lawyers Association (NMTLA) and chairs the NMTLA Annual Tort Seminar.

### Victor Reyes – Attorney

Victor Reyes represents individuals and families in personal injury and civil rights matters, focusing on people who have suffered catastrophic injuries or whose civil rights have been violated. Before joining Youngers Law, he served in senior New Mexico state government leadership roles, including Legislative Director to Governor Michelle Lujan Grisham and Deputy Superintendent of the New Mexico Regulation and Licensing Department, where he advised executive leadership on legal and legislative matters and helped lead statewide initiatives.

Mr. Reyes earned his law degree from the University of New Mexico School of Law, graduating in the top ten percent of his class and receiving the Dean’s Award and the Torts Scholar Award. During law school he worked in the chambers of United States District Judge Kathleen Cardone of the Western District of Texas, and served as a teaching assistant in Legal Writing and Argumentation and in Constitutional Law.
